One commitment I’ll always keep is this – sharing my frugal finds with you.  To that end, take a look at what I found at JCPenney last weekend:

Black acrylic shawl-collar shrug with faux-leather toggle closure by Arizona Jeans Co.  Cute, yes?  And I can style it in approximately one billion ways.  However, its original price of $44 dollars was insulting for such a cheap-to-make item.  But good things come to those that wait, and this sweater is now just $9.99.  They have it in black, gray, cream and BRIGHT red.  Remember to go up a size, though.  It is a Junior’s brand.

Pants/Leggings, or peggings (name and reason to buy them shamelessly stolen from WhatIWore2Day) in dark, solid gray with silver button closure by Oxford and Regent.  I love these pants as they are thick and long – two things hard to find in traditional leggings.  Once again, though, Penney’s slapped them with a $44 price tag.  Too rich for my blood, especially to spend on a non-staple-of-my-wardrobe item.  But!  Penney’s is closing out much of their fall trendy items for 70% off, so I snatched these up for the low price of $11.99.

Best of all, I had a gift card from Lou’s Mom (thank you Mom!), so my total expenditure was a mere $8.99.

If you need a few more pieces for you winter wardrobe – and let’s face it, winter in MN will be here for at least another 4 months – head on over to Penney’s and check out all their 70% off racks.  Pack a snack, though, there’s a ton to sort through.
